Jogging in East Northamptonshire offers diverse routes through a landscape characterized by gently rolling hills, extensive river systems, and ancient woodlands. The region features numerous reservoirs and wetlands, providing varied scenery for runners. Trails often follow the River Nene or wind through managed country parks and nature reserves. This varied terrain ensures a range of running experiences, from flat riverside paths to more undulating woodland routes.

Frequently Asked Questions

What kind of terrain can I expect on running routes in East Northamptonshire?

East Northamptonshire offers a diverse range of running terrain. You'll find routes through gently rolling hills, ancient woodlands like Fineshade Woods and Fermyn Woods Country Park, and extensive river systems, particularly along the River Nene. Many trails also circle scenic reservoirs and lakes such as Stanwick Lakes and Pitsford Water, providing varied surfaces from riverside paths to woodland trails.

Are there many running routes available in East Northamptonshire?

Yes, East Northamptonshire is a fantastic area for runners. There are over 300 running routes available, catering to various fitness levels. These include 25 easy routes, over 230 moderate options, and nearly 60 more challenging trails for experienced runners.

What are some scenic landmarks or natural features I can see while jogging in East Northamptonshire?

Jogging in East Northamptonshire offers many picturesque sights. You can explore the tranquil River Nene and its associated wetlands, ancient woodlands such as Fineshade Woods and Fermyn Woods, or the expansive waters of Stanwick Lakes and Pitsford Water. Historic sites like the area around Fotheringhay Castle also provide scenic backdrops. Additionally, you might spot the impressive Welland Viaduct or the historic Lyveden Manor House on certain routes.

Are there any family-friendly running trails in East Northamptonshire?

Absolutely! Many country parks in East Northamptonshire offer excellent family-friendly running options. Stanwick Lakes features accessible trails around its lakes, perfect for a family outing. Irchester Country Park and Barnwell Country Park also provide networks of trails suitable for all ages, often with additional facilities like playgrounds and visitor centers.

Which running routes are suitable for dogs in East Northamptonshire?

Many trails in East Northamptonshire are dog-friendly, but it's always best to check specific park rules. Generally, routes through woodlands like Fineshade Woods and Fermyn Woods Country Park, and paths around Stanwick Lakes, are popular choices for runners with dogs. Remember to keep dogs under control, especially near wildlife or livestock, and adhere to any local signage regarding leads.

What is the best time of year to go running in East Northamptonshire?

Spring and autumn are often considered the best seasons for running in East Northamptonshire, offering pleasant temperatures and beautiful scenery. Spring brings blooming wildflowers, especially bluebells in ancient woodlands like Everdon Stubbs, while autumn showcases vibrant foliage. Summer can be lovely, but be mindful of warmer temperatures, especially on exposed routes. Winter running is also possible, though trails can be muddy, particularly in woodland areas or after heavy rain.

Are there any long-distance running options in the region?

Yes, East Northamptonshire has several options for longer runs. The Nene Way is a significant long-distance path following the River Nene, offering extensive mileage. The St Leonard's Church, Apethorpe – The White Swan, Woodnewton loop from Oundle is a challenging 32 km route, and the River Nene Path – Stanwick Lakes loop from Rushden covers nearly 23 km, providing excellent endurance challenges.

Where can I find parking and public transport options for popular running spots like Stanwick Lakes or Fineshade Woods?

Many popular running locations in East Northamptonshire, such as Stanwick Lakes, Fineshade Woods, and Irchester Country Park, offer dedicated parking facilities, often with a fee. For public transport, options vary by location. It's advisable to check local bus routes to nearby towns or villages, which may have connections to these sites. For example, Stanwick Lakes is accessible from nearby towns like Irthlingborough and Rushden.

What do other runners say about the trails in East Northamptonshire?

The running routes in East Northamptonshire are highly regarded by the komoot community, boasting an average rating of 5.0 stars from numerous reviews. Runners frequently praise the diverse scenery, from tranquil riverside paths along the Nene to the peaceful trails through ancient woodlands, and the well-maintained paths around reservoirs like Stanwick Lakes. Many appreciate the variety of routes suitable for different abilities.

Are there any circular running routes in East Northamptonshire?

Yes, many of the best running routes in East Northamptonshire are circular, allowing you to start and finish in the same location. Examples include the Stanwick Lakes loop from Irthlingborough, which is a moderate 8.4 km route, and the Fineshade Woods – Cycle Centre and Grounds Cafe loop from Top Lodge, a 13.6 km trail through the woods. These loops are ideal for exploring the varied landscapes without needing to retrace your steps.

Can I find amenities like cafes or pubs along running routes in East Northamptonshire?

Yes, several running areas and routes in East Northamptonshire offer amenities. For instance, Stanwick Lakes has a visitor centre with a cafe. Fineshade Woods also features a cafe at its Cycle Centre. In many villages along routes like the Nene Way or Lyveden Way, you'll find local pubs and cafes where you can refuel. For example, the Bike Hire and Café – Fineshade Woods loop from King's Cliffe specifically highlights a cafe along its path.
